Group: SRD; Subgroup: FO metrics
![]() |
The FO metric evaluates the overall efficiency of observing. foNv: out of 18000.00 sq degrees, the area receives at least X and a median of Y visits (out of 825, if compared to benchmark). fOArea: this many sq deg (out of 18000.00 sq deg if compared to benchmark) receives at least 825 visits.
Group: SRD; Subgroup: FO metrics; Slicer: HealpixSlicer | |
fOArea | 7271.64 |
fOArea/benchmark | 0.40 |
fOArea_750 | 18667.57 |
fONv MedianNvis | 817.00 |
fONv MinNvis | 763.00 |
fONv/benchmark MedianNvis | 0.99 |
fONv/benchmark MinNvis | 0.92 |
